Modeling for opto-electronic oscillator considering the nonlinearity of microwave amplifier

2013 
A new model is proposed to analyze the oscillation power and phase noise characteristics of oscillation signal in the single-loop opto-electronic oscillator (OEO), and then verified by experiments. Compared with previous models, in our model, the nonlinearity of not only the E/O modulator but also the microwave amplifier is included in calculating systematic nonlinearities, so this model can describe OEO more accurately than previous models. Experiments verify the correctness of our model and results show that, compared with previous models, the oscillation power is about 10 dB lower and the minimum single-sideband phase noise after optimization is ∼3 dB higher in our experiments. © 2012 Wiley Periodicals, Inc.
